70isaLimitNotaTarget · 18/02/2015 12:55

ah Joyful Easter Trees are A Thing a thing of beauty Smile

I got some twigs (about 5' long) bound the thick end, pushed into a tub of putty to set then painted white. The putty tub goes into a nice felt Easter bucket .
Decorated with little pastel eggs (Pound Shop).

I made a Hallowe'en Tree last year (black painted twigs, skulls, bats, couple of black cats, a huge spider and a £shop doll wrapped in masking tape and cobwebby stuff then more cobwebby stuff on the tree). 'Twas lovely .
